Travel assistance benefits are funds that are intended to assist Medicaid clients with transportation costs. These funds are only meant to assist clients to get to and from medically necessary appointments and are not intended to cover the full expense of the trip. When the client meets certain requirements, they may request assistance with mileage or another method of travel. The transportation method is based on the client’s medical needs and cost effectiveness.
